Options to classic truck transfer involve barge and rail transportation. All things becoming equal, barges are by far the most economical process for transporting waste. For example, according to the U.S. Department of Transportation's “Environmental Benefits of Inland Barge here Transportation” report, just one barge has the cargo ability of 30 jumbo-sized rail cars and trucks and a hundred and twenty substantial semi-vans.
